On a typical quarter slot, the machine offers anywhere between 1 and 5 coins per spin. That equates to $0.25 for minimum bettors, and $1.25 for folks playing the maximum.
Most of the time, unfortunately, no – there is no benefit to placing a max bet. On most slot machines, the payout ratio for wins will increase equally with the bet you place. If you wager $1 and win $2, a $10 bet would have won $20, just as a $100 bet would have won $200.

Slot machines contain random number generators that can generate thousands of numbers per second, each of which is associated with a different combination of symbols. Whether you win or lose is determined by the random number generated in the exact instant you activate each play—if it matches a payline, you win.

The reason for the high volatility of slot machines is due to their pay tables. They offer large prizes at the top, which creates an uneven pay structure. Given the jackpots, these games must be programmed to pay out less often to make up for large prizes.
Some video slot machines have up to 25+ lines that can be played at once. However, many physical slot machines have somewhere between 3-5 lines, and classic models only have a single line.

There are no such thing as “hot” or “cold” slots. Each spin gives the player an independent event, which has its own odds of winning, unaffected by recent or past outcomes.

Is There Any Reason to Stop the Reels? There's no reason that would impact the outcome of your game. In fact, by not stopping the reels and letting a spin (or free games, or whatever animation is going on) do its thing, you're avoiding hitting the bet button as quickly, so you're putting less money at risk.
The outcome of the next spin is not dictated by what's come before it, thanks to the random number generator (RNG), so whether you stay on a machine or move on really is going to be more about what makes you feel good or not.
